Administrators ladyshanny Posted April 26, 2017 Administrators Share Posted April 26, 2017 Hi @TBD - dry mouth can be a result of going too low-carb. Are you eating starchy veggies (yams, potatoes, winter squash etc) with at least one meal each day? Give us a rundown on your eating habits and meal composition over the past few days and we can see if anything stands out. PS. Our water recommendation is half an ounce of water per pound of bodyweight...........so 8 glasses is enough if you weigh approximately 120#.
